Ciranova Intensive Cleaner is a water-based degreasing cleaner for deep cleaning oiled timber floors. Whether it is soap residue, surface grime or stubborn spots, Ciranova describes it as cutting through the build-up and leaving the surface clean and ready for maintenance, and as suitable for interior use and formulated not to strip or damage the wood.
Suitability and use as stated by Ciranova.
Old soap residue and grime sit on the surface and stop a maintenance oil absorbing evenly. Ciranova describes Intensive Cleaner as cutting through that build-up, so when you re-oil, the oil soaks in and bonds properly, and the floor comes back evenly.
Intensive Cleaner is for a deep clean, or to prep an oiled floor before re-oiling, not for routine weekly cleaning, which takes a gentler floor soap. If the floor is new to you, test an out-of-the-way patch first, and do not over-wet the timber.
Ciranova describes it as applied by hand or with a buffing machine, with no rinsing needed in most cases.
